About

Xiao Shen is a robotics researcher whose work focuses on advancing simultaneous localization and mapping (SLAM) for autonomous systems, particularly in indoor environments. His most notable contribution is the development of a LiDAR SLAM system that integrates an improved particle filter with enhanced scan matching techniques, designed specifically for unmanned delivery robots. This work addresses critical challenges in robot navigation—such as drift and computational inefficiency—by refining how robots estimate their position and build maps in real time.
